Tom Holland to star in anthology series ‘The Crowded Room’ for Apple TV+

Tom Holland is set to star in a new anthology series for Apple TV+ titled The Crowded Room. The Crowded Room will explore the true stories of those who have struggled and learned to live with mental illness.

Academy Award winner Akiva Goldsman (A Beautiful Mind) is writing and executive producing. Holland, who recently starred in Apple original film Cherry, will star as the lead in the first season and executive produce. 

The 10-episode first season will be based on biography The Minds of Billy Milligan by author Daniel Keyes. Holland will portray Milligan, the first person acquitted of a crime for having dissociative identity disorder, formerly known as multiple personality disorder.

Rage Against the Machine push back dates for reunion tour to 2022

Rage Against the Machine announced on Thursday that they’re pushing their tour dates to March 2022. Run the Jewels will open for Rage on most of the dates of the Public Service Announcement Tour.

The rescheduled tour will kick-off in El Paso, Texas on March 31, 2022 at Don Haskins Center, and will include a few festival dates in there as well, but not Coachella. Rage was supposed to perform at the 2020 edition of Coachella before it was postponed due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

Check out Paul Rudd in the new trailer for “Ghostbusters: Afterlife”

Sony Pictures Entertainment just dropped the new trailer for the upcoming supernatural comedy drama Ghostbusters: Afterlife. The film features Paul Rudd as Mr. Grooberson, a teacher familiar with the Ghostbusters legacy.

The trailer (seen here) shows Mr. Grooberson (Rudd) encounter the Mini-Pufts, small versions of the Stay Puft Marshmallow Man. The Mini-Pufts are seen causing mayhem in a grocery store. Sony also released a trailer for the film back in December that shows a small town being taken over by supernatural forces.

Ghostbusters: Afterlife takes place 30 years after Ghostbusters II and is the sequel to Ghostbusters (1984) and Ghostbusters II (1989), which starred Bill Murray, Dan Aykroyd, Harold Ramis and Ernie Hudson.  Murray, Aykroyd, Hudson and Sigourney Weaver will reprise their roles as Dr. Peter Venkman, Dr. Raymond “Ray” Stantz, Dr. Winston Zeddemore and Dana Barrett in Ghostbusters: Afterlife.

Ghostbusters: Afterlife opens in theaters Nov. 11.

Take a look at the new trailer for Disney’s “Cruella”

Emma Stone portrays the titular Disney villain in the trailer (seen here) for the upcoming Cruella. 

In the trailer, Cruella wants to take out Emma Thompson’s Baroness von Hellman, who is unknowingly mentoring Cruella at her fashion company. The devilish Cruella also steals the Baroness’ dalmatians and commits other crimes around 1970s London.

Cruella, based on 101 Dalmatians villain Cruella de Vil, will be coming to theaters and Disney+ with premier access on May 28. Aside from Stone and Thompson, the film stars Joel Fry, Paul Walter Hauser, Emily Beecham and Mark Strong.

Paramore to reissue their 2007 album ‘Riot!’ on silver vinyl

Front woman Hayley Williams announced in a video on Twitter that Paramore will reissue their 2007 album ‘Riot!’ on silver vinyl as part of their label Fueled By Ramen’s 25th anniversary celebration.

Riot! was the band’s second studio album, which came out in June 2007.  It featured such songs as ‘That’s What You Get’, ‘Crushcrushcrush’ and ‘Hallelujah’. Paramore have partnered with the digital marketing firm Creative Allies for the reissue to give the band’s fans the opportunity to design special ‘Riot!’ art that will be sold as merchandise on the Paramore web store. Helen Mirren to play Israeli Prime Minister Golda Meir in ‘Golda’

Helen Mirren will portray Golda Meir, Israel’s only female Prime Minister, in a biopic titled Golda. The screenplay follows the decisions Meir made during the Yom Kippur War in 1973. The war involved Egypt, Syria and Jordan launching a surprise attack on the Sinai Peninsula and the Golan Heights.

Academy Award winning filmmaker Guy Nattiv (Skin) is serving as director. Nattiv said in a statement: “As someone who was born during the Yom Kippur War, I am honored to tell this fascinating story about the first and only woman to ever lead Israel. Nicholas Martin’s brilliant script dives into Golda’s final chapter as the country faces a deadly surprise attack during the holiest day of the year, a core of delusional generals undermining Golda’s judgement, all the while undergoing secret treatments for her illness. I could not be more excited to work with the legendary Miss Mirren to bring this epic, emotional and complex story to life.”

Golda is expected to begin production in October.

Marvel Studios debuts trailer for Disney+ series ‘Loki’

Marvel Studio’s have released the trailer for the Disney+ series Loki, set for a June 11 debut. Marvel Studios’ Loki features the God of Mischief as he steps out of his brother’s shadow in a new series that takes place after the events of Avengers: Endgame.

Tom Hiddleston returns as the title character, joined by Owen Wilson, Gugu Mbatha-Raw, Sophia Di Martino, Wunmi Mosaku and Richard E. Grant. Kate Herron directs Loki, and Michael Waldron is head writer.

Anthrax’s Charlie Benante and famous rock friends cover Rush’s ‘Subdivisions’

Anthrax drummer Charlie Benante and his all-star friends are paying tribute to the legendary band Rush. 

Benante recently announced that he is releasing a special album called “Silver Linings” on May 14th featuring all-star quarantine jams of classic rock cover songs from bands like KISS and Iron Maiden. In addition, Charlie has revealed plans to released a special Rush tribute EP on Record Store Day and has shared a quarantine jam of the band’s classic hit “Subdivisions”.  Along with Benante, the Rush cover features Alex Skolnick (TESTAMENT), Roberto “Ra” Diaz (SUICIDAL TENDENCIES), Brandon Yeagley (CROBOT) and Mee Eun Kim (TRANS-SIBERIAN ORCHESTRA).
